Position Summary

Academic Advisors empower students in their ability to explore their educational opportunities, set and establish goals, and achieve academic success. Advisors provide educational planning for students by developing an academic plan and providing academic and career advising that meets the needs of the student in a manner that demonstrates commitment to the college mission and our diverse student population. Collaborate with Academic and Student Affairs departments throughout the college to assist students. Support college enrollment efforts through delivering new student advising through Orientation programming and continued student advising.

Essential Job Functions and Responsibilities

  • Development of appropriate education plans to establish academic and career goals and advise students on selection of courses
  • Advise a specialty student area (athletics, students with disabilities, allied health, student veterans, etc.)
  • Advise students individually and in group sessions using prescriptive, developmental, and intrusive relationships to monitor student progress toward established educational goals
  • Assist with the facilitation of new student orientation programming by presenting college information and advising students
  • Help students gain or improve necessary skills for academic success including goal setting, development of study skills, and career/major planning
  • Maintain documentation in student records that is objective, complete, and accurate
  • Train and assist students with myMCC, self-service and student planning tools to effectively navigate and utilize online resources for registration and course planning
  • Proactively monitor at-risk students to identify opportunities to develop and improve academic success
  • Assess students in crisis and assess the need to refer to the appropriate college resources
  • Evaluate transfer credits for course waivers
  • Conduct outreach to students (phone calls, emails, advising on wheels, drop-in advising) to support the college’s retention efforts
  • Assist in providing training on advising techniques and theory to new Academic Advisors, College Success Coaches and other college staff
  • Work in partnership with faculty and/or College Success Coaches to problem solve issues and ensure students are on track for success
  • Participate in development and presentation of seminars, workshops and college events
  • Contribute to the assessment of techniques used within the advising team regarding services provided and propose changes to the delivery of advising services to the Coordinator of Academic Advising and/or Dean of Enrollment Services in an effort of continuous improvement
  • Participate in college meetings and committees as assigned
  • Work collaboratively with other (e.g. colleagues, stakeholders, vendors) to accomplish functions and responsibilities
  • Assume additional duties as assigned by immediate supervisor

Required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ree from a regionally accredited institution
  • Experience in serving diverse student populations
  • One-year academic advising or student support services experience; or Graduate level coursework in College Student Personnel, Higher Education, Advising or related field; or hold an Academic Advising Graduate Certificate
  • Start or obtain a Graduate Academic Advisor Certification within three years of hire if less than 2 (two) years of Academic Advising experience, or no Master’s degree
